Latest Patents
Andersson's latest patents include a convertible top for motor vehicles and a sensor designed to detect the rotational position of rotatable devices. The convertible top patent describes a soft top that features a linkage mounted pivotably on soft-top supports. This design allows the soft top to move from a rear storage position to a locking position above the windscreen frame. The innovation ensures that during the closing process, the soft top is stopped in a premounted position, supported by a spring-loaded stop, which reduces the forces required for closing. The second patent focuses on a sensor that detects the rotational position of devices such as shafts or hatches. This sensor incorporates a position detector and a potentiometer, enhanced by a cam mechanism to improve accuracy within part of the rotation range.
Career Highlights
Throughout his career, Kaj Andersson has worked with prominent companies in the automotive sector. He has been associated with Cts Fahrzeug-dachsysteme GmbH and Saab Automobile Aktiebolag.
